Transaction 5dbcc07b8705f0b84954c7a24435c2a884394ed3623d08dec6c47e8be6d3ff03
1 Input
1 Output
-
5dbcc07b8705f0b84954c7a24435c2a884394ed3623d08dec6c47e8be6d3ff03:0
- value
- 1152376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c9d8d61c6ced12fc568a6ed99a9ec2a5350c753 OP_EQUAL
- address
- 3EWXGKjk2ADrU6gigteWkQquKg5LxszErj